~~ FIVE SHIRDI SAI BABA INFO CENTRE'S

TO COME UP IN INDIA ~~
Tuesday 31st Aug`2010
The Hindu

Hyderabad: The Long felt need for a facility to ensure a hassle-free


Darshan of Sri Sai Baba at Shirdi along with accommodation has been
fulfilled with the opening of an Information Centre in Hyderabad.
The Centre, located at the S Radhaswamy Foundation, Unit No. 110,
Deepthi House, YMCA Complex, Secunderabad was inaugurated by
chief minister K Rosaiah on Monday 30th August`2010.

It will be Managed by the Shri Saibaba Sansthan Trust, Shirdi.


Rosaiah said the Centre will immensely benefit the large number of
devotees who visit Shirdi from the state. “The majority of the
Worshippers at Shirdi are from Andhra Pradesh.
As their numbers are increasing steadily, the centre will be helpful in
arranging darshan and accommodation for them,” he said.

Many Sai Baba temples are coming up in the state as the devotees are
swelling. “During my stint as the Finance Minister, the late chief
minister YS Rajasekhara Reddy had suggested bringing
the Sai Baba temples under the purview of the endowments
department. But I opposed the move stating that it would create an
unnecessary controversy. YSR understood the complexity of the issue
and dropped the proposal,” Rosaiah said.

The Chairman of Sai Baba Sansthan Trust, Shirdi, Jayant Sasane said
the Information Centre would provide Online booking of
Darshan, accommodation and other facilities.
The Temple committee has constructed new facilities to provide
accommodation to 15,000 devotees. It has constructed a huge
‘Prasadalaya’ that can serve over 25,000 devotees daily.
